The MPXV10GC7U belongs to the category of pressure sensors.
It is used for measuring absolute pressure in various applications.
The sensor is typically available in a small package suitable for surface mount technology (SMT).
The essence of the MPXV10GC7U lies in its ability to accurately measure pressure in a compact form factor.
The sensor is usually supplied in reels or trays, with quantities varying based on manufacturer specifications.
The MPXV10GC7U typically has 6 pins: 1. Vout (Analog Output) 2. Vss (Ground) 3. Vdd (Supply Voltage) 4. N/C (No Connection) 5. N/C (No Connection) 6. N/C (No Connection)
The MPXV10GC7U operates on the principle of piezoresistive sensing, where changes in pressure cause a corresponding change in resistance, which is then converted into an analog voltage output.
The MPXV10GC7U is commonly used in: - Medical devices - HVAC systems - Industrial automation - Consumer electronics
Some alternative models to the MPXV10GC7U include: - MPXV5010GC6U - MPXV7002DP
